AUCTIONS NORTH OTAGO FARMERS' CO-OP. LAND AUCTION LAND AUCTION OUTSTANDING STUD FARM OUTSTANDING STUD FARM FRIDAY. NOVEMBER 22. 1963. AT 2.30 P.M. ODDFELLOWS HALL. COQUET STREET, OAMARU ■ THE NORTH OTAGO FARMVERS’ CO-OP. ASSN., LTD . lias .been favoured with instructions I from MESSRS KENNEDY BROS., "Willowglen," Windsor, Ito offer for sale as above their ‘desirable properties as follows: LOT 1— 238 acres 1 rood FREEHOLD, together with sound three-bed-roomed home, sunroom, lounge, living room, kitchen, etc. This home is set in lovely sheltered surroundings, alongside a large orchard. IMPROVEMENTS include woo! shed, large concrete double garage. concrete killing shed, two large implement sheds and hay shed 16000 b/s). cattle yards, steel sheep yards, and shower sheep dip. fuel tank, permanent sheep shelters capable of holding 3500 bales hay. This property is well subdivided by good fences, with water in every padcock. There “is an established 60-acre stand of lucerne. balance mostly young pasture. LOT 2 117 acres 3 roods 13 perches L. together with three-bed-roomed home in good condition. Large hay barn and implement shed, garage. Cyclone sheep yards. This farm is also well fenced and watered, 25 acres of lucerne, balance young pasture. NOTE— Both these properties have been farmed as one unit by Messrs Kennedy Bros., but will be offered as two separate lots The homestead block has been in the Kennedy family for 61 years, and is being sold now. only for health reasons. Both these properties are for genuine sale. 700 stud sheep, together with 90-100 head of cattle have been wintered this season. This highly productive land can be recommended by the Auctioneers as easily worked and ideal for cropping, gratin* and fattening, for stud or flock purposes. SITUATED 11 miles from Oamaru on sealed highway. POSSESSION will be given on March 2. 1964. INSPECTION: Arrangements to inspect must be made with the Auctioneers. Member of Real Estate Inst, of N.Z. 2245 AUCTION SALE OF GRAZING RUN. FRIDAY. NOVEMBER 22, 1963. AT 2 P,M. In the R.S.A. Rooms. Main street. Gore. The SOUTHLAND FARMERS CO-OP ASSN., LTD., GORE, have been favoured with instructions from Mr Les. A. Charleson, "Hill Crest," Wendon Valley, to offer at the above time and place his desirable grazing run consisting of 1383 acres (freehold). BUILDINGS: A good wooden home (well kept), comprising 4 bedrooms, lounge, kitchen, bathroom, laundry, etc. Good water supply. Electric power. Woolshed (200), new iron implement shed, loose box. cow byre, dip. This is a particularly good grazing run. lying very well to the sun with a north-west-erly aspect, and with a great potential, 300/400 acres plough - able. With topdressing and further subdivision the carrying capacity could be greatly increased. It is handily situated being 21 miles by tar-sealed road from Gore and 3J miles from Waikaka township. This sale presents an excellent opportunity to anyone seeking an ideal tussock block. The sole reason this property is being offered is because of health reasons.
